We go to Ogunquit beach. There is parking right at the beach which make lugging your stuff much easier. The beach area is quite large so there is space to choose from.

York Beach area is very pretty, but the beach itself is much smaller and you have to park along the road which can end up being a hike from the beach.

Ogunquit is the most beautiful beach. Mid September can be tricky and likely not "sit on the beach" weather, but nice for walking. Ogunquit has nice shops, walking on the marginal way, and you could go up to Kennebunkport and poke around too.
